开发者社区> 问答> 正文

怎么把一个对象放进list里面?报错

	PrpsPayRecVo prpsPayRecVo = new PrpsPayRecVo();
		List<PrpSinsured> prpSinsuredss = new ArrayList();
		prpSinsuredss.add(prpsPayRecVo);

怎么把prpsPayRecVo放进prpSinsuredss里面 add会报错

展开
收起
爱吃鱼的程序员 2020-06-08 10:39:32 486 0
1 条回答
写回答
取消 提交回答
  • https://developer.aliyun.com/profile/5yerqm5bn5yqg?spm=a2c6h.12873639.0.0.6eae304abcjaIB

    你声明的是

    PrpSinsured

    存的是 

    PrpsPayRecVo

    当然报错 

    所言极是。应当是:List<prpsPayRecVo>prpSinsuredss=newArrayList();

    同意楼上观点!

    存放和声明的对象类型不一致。

    PrpsPayRecVoprpsPayRecVo=newPrpsPayRecVo();List<prpsPayRecVo>prpSinsuredss=newArrayList();prpSinsuredss.add(prpsPayRecVo);
    改成范型,要么就不声明类型,要么强转

    首先你得有一个对象。。。

    2020-06-08 10:39:44
    赞同 展开评论 打赏
问答地址:
问答排行榜
最热
最新

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载